BB河牌单色冷跟注(BB River Cold Call Monotone)
Refers to the big blind player cold calling a bet on the river when the board is monotone all of the same suit, meaning the player has not invested any chips in the current betting round previously.
Term Analysis
BB River Cold Call Monotone is a compound term that describes a specific poker scenario: the player is in the Big Blind (BB) position, the hand has reached the River, and all community cards are of the same suit (Monotone). At this point, facing a bet, the player chooses to Cold Call.
Position and Action
- BB (Big Blind): The big blind is a forced bet position preflop, usually at a positional disadvantage postflop, but on the river the positional advantage depends on whether the player acts last.
- Cold Call: Refers to calling a bet directly without having invested any chips in the current betting round. On the river, a cold call typically means the player has not bet or raised in that round and simply calls the opponent's bet.
Board Texture
- Monotone: All community cards (the visible cards on the board) are of the same suit. For example, on the river, if the flop and turn were all hearts, the board is monotone. This board structure makes a flush possible, and the likelihood of a flush is high since four or five cards of the same suit are already present.
Strategic Implications
- Motivation for Cold Call: On a monotone river, a cold call often indicates the player holds a weak flush or is attempting to bluff catch. Since strong hands (e.g., the nut flush) typically raise, a cold call may suggest a hand strength between marginal and medium.
- Risk and Balance: When the big blind cold calls on the river, it is necessary to evaluate the opponent's betting range. A monotone board increases the probability of a flush, so a cold call can be interpreted as "I have a flush but it's not strong" or "I may not have a flush, but I think you're bluffing."
Typical Example
- Suppose the flop is A♠ 9♠ 3♠, the turn is J♠, and the river is 5♠ (all spades). The opponent bets 2/3 pot on the river, and the big blind calls. This action is a BB River Cold Call Monotone.
Caveats
- This term is not a standard poker textbook term; it is more of an abbreviation used by the player community for a specific scenario. In practice, it is advisable to use a full description to avoid ambiguity.
